Astana went top of the Kazakhstan league on Friday courtesy of a 2 – 0 win over Tobol and this is what they will want to carry to their next game, when they start their Champions League journey against Romanian side Cluj, and they will have the advantage of having played more competitive matches ahead of this clash. Astana have three wins in their last five outings and the same in 10 matches ahead of this game. They have five wins in 15 and two in their last five at home. In their last three Champions League matches, Astana have scored no goal but in the 14 Champions League matches played at home, they have lost just one. On the other hand, Cluj’s matches lately, have been friendly games and they go to this clash straight after a loss to Viitorul in the Romanian Super Cup. After that slip they will be hoping to recover in this Champions League clash before embarking on domestic action. Cluj have three wins in their last five matches and seven wins in 10. Of the last 10 matches, five have been competitive, with only three producing wins. In their last 10 away matches, they have five wins but in the Champions League Cluj have no win in their last two matches, while they have two wins in their last seven Champions League matches. They are unbeaten in six away matches in the Champions League and have managed just two clean sheets in the last 12 away Champions League matches.
Cluj have not lost in the last six away Champions League matches, but here they meet an Astana side with just a loss in 14 Champions League. With Astana having played a lot more competitively of late, we believe they will be the fitter side and we’ll thus go with a win for them.
